**Q: How do I unlock the GPU memory profiler on Corvid workstations?**

A: The Halcyon profiler attaches to training jobs and snapshots per-kernel VRAM allocation. Contractors get read-only traces by default. For full allocation timelines, launch with the deep flag and accept the audit prompt. First launch on a fresh workstation asks for an unlock; type the recovery passphrase printed directly below this entry.

vault phrase of tajeg-tageg = pelix-druix-holius-briael-zorwyn-frawyn-fraox-norok-drueth-aldiel

### Step 7: Enable hot-reloading in Copperline

Future maintainers, this is the step where Copperline stops needing restarts for config changes. The watcher process now monitors the config directory and applies diffs live — neat, but be careful: some keys (anything under the connection pool section) still require a full restart, and the reloader will just log a warning and skip them. To turn the watcher on, set the following configuration values.

config for kafof-bawef:
holath:
  log_level: debug
  metrics_host: metrics.holath.qorvelsys.internal
  pin: 2191
  pool_size: 32

**Alert: tailfox CLI — tail session failures**

The tailfox CLI is failing to open tail sessions against the Greymarsh log brokers. Error rate above 30% for 15 minutes. Release impact: deploy verification relies on live tails, so holds may be needed. Workaround: use the batch-pull mode until sessions recover. Triage steps and current broker status are tracked on the page below.

dashboard of bajef-bageg = https://confluence.lumiclabs.internal/browse/browse/pages/display/93ae